Taking an NFL team halfway around the world is a major undertaking, but taking its equipment operation with it adds another level of planning. The Rams are bringing roughly 25,000 pounds of equipment to Australia for their 2026 season opener, with Brendan Burger and his staff working through everything from 90 equipment cases and international shipping to customs requirements and making sure the team has what it needs when it arrives.
